The End and Ultimate Solution to Evil


As I write down my thoughts on Psalm 140 this morning, I am looking out on a stormy sea from the balcony of my brother’s second floor condo in South Padre Island ... way down here at the “tip of Texas”. The surf is pounding, due to the recent hurricane, Isaac, that came in northeast of us … and the skies are filled with dark clouds. The radar tells me there are thunder storms about to sweep over us. It is a fitting setting for contemplating this Psalm which focuses on the problem of evil and the reality of wicked men in our everyday lives.

As it is with you and me, the writer of this Psalm was constantly being confronted with evil and the presence of wicked men. Truly, the Dark Kingdom constantly affects each of us personally and profoundly. But, the solution to it all, as the Psalmist so clearly sets before us, is squarely and rightfully in the hands of our great and good God.

When I first cranked up my computer this morning, I found that my brother, Ron, had left me a message. It said, “I watched the sunrise out over the ocean this morning. It reminded me that the Son is coming.” Amen, brother Ron! And therein lies the ultimate solution to evil and wickedness. Jesus is coming! Jesus is going to take care of it. Two scriptures come to mind and, with them, I will leave you to fill in the blanks with your own thoughts as the Lord teaches you about this subject.

Put on the full armor of God, so that you can take your stand against the devil’s schemes. For our struggle is not against flesh and blood, but against the rulers, against the authorities, against the powers of this dark world and against the spiritual forces of evil in the heavenly realms. Therefore put on the full armor of God, so that when the day of evil comes, you may be able to stand your ground, and after you have done everything, to stand. Eph 6:11-13

Then the end will come, when he hands over the kingdom to God the Father after he has destroyed all dominion, authority and power. For he must reign until he has put all his enemies under his feet. The last enemy to be destroyed is death. 1 Cor 15:24-26
